Drowning incident this Dangerous Canal in 2007.
The body of the missing teenage girl swept away in the Sungei Pandan canal on Sunday afternoon has been found.
The police alerted the media at 1pm that Debra Koh's body had been found in the open seas near the river mouth of Sungei Pandan.
The teenager, along with three friends, had been swept away by strong currents while trying to retrieve a handphone that had fallen into the canal. The accident happened near Block 182 Bukit Batok West Avenue 8 at about 3.40pm.
One of the teenage boys managed to swim ashore 20 minutes later, while the other boy and girl were rescued 40 minutes later.
All three were taken to the National University Hospital where they were treated for minor injuries
In response to media queries, the Public Utilities Board (PUB) said, “A canal can look quite dry but as it is fed by a system of drains, heavy rain that occurs elsewhere within the catchment can bring down a rapid surge of water within minutes.”
This is especially so in Singapore, where short but intensive periods of tropical rainfall results in the rapid build-up of water in drains and canals, said PUB.
PUB added that the section of the canal where the teenagers had entered is usually dry, but it has a catchment size of 173 ha, which is about one-third the size of Bukit Batok town.
The four teenagers were believed to have entered the canal, next to Block 182 Bukit Batok, to retrieve a handphone that had fallen into the waters.
Police said the two boys and two girls, aged between 13 and 14, were then swept downstream.
One of the boys managed to swim to safety and was picked up by a foreign worker near the International Business Park.
Shortly afterwards, the other boy and a girl were rescued by police and passers-by between Jurong East and Clementi, after they were spotted clinging on to a buoy.
All three were sent to the National University Hospital where they were treated for minor injuries.
The four-kilometre long river starts from Bukit Batok West Avenue 8 and flows down to the sea.
Eye witnesses said the water level in the river rose rapidly during the afternoon downpour.
Some even described the water in the river as fast-flowing and swift.
Under the Active, Beautiful, Clean Waters (ABC Waters) Programme, a section of Bukit Batok West Outlet Drain from Bukit Batok West Ave 8 to PIE will undergo a makeover where a new lookout deck and lawn area will be developed to create additional communal spaces for community bonding.
